Recently viewed items
Estimated delivery dates: May 15, 2025 - May 20, 2025
Estimated delivery dates: May 15, 2025 - May 20, 2025
Estimated delivery dates: May 15, 2025 - May 20, 2025
Estimated delivery dates: May 15, 2025 - May 20, 2025
£15.99 – £31.98
In Stock
Estimated delivery dates: May 15, 2025 - May 20, 2025
Estimated delivery dates: May 15, 2025 - May 20, 2025